About Buttsbury

Buttsbury is a small village located in the county of Essex, in the east of England. It lies within the CM4 postcode area and is situated near the town of Brentwood. The village is primarily residential, with a mix of traditional and modern housing. It is well-connected to nearby towns and cities via road networks, including the A120, which provides access to Chelmsford and the M25 motorway. Buttsbury has a local community centre and a few small shops, offering basic amenities to residents. The surrounding area is largely rural, with open fields and woodland nearby, providing opportunities for walking and outdoor activities. The village maintains a quiet, settled atmosphere, typical of many Essex communities.
